Let the number be X.
So 2/3 of a number would be (2/3)x and 1/5 of the same number would be (1/5)x. Therefore, (2/3)x+(1/5)x=39. Next, you combine like terms by converting the fractions: (10/15)x+(3/15)x=39. Now, you add the fractions. (13/15)x=39. Lastly you divide both sides by 13/15 or multiply both sides by 15/13. x=45. That number would be 45.
<u>If you would like to check</u>, you would do 2/3(45) or 90/3 which is 30 and do 1/5(45) or 45/5 which is 9. 30+9=39
